Cleaver Brooks is looking for a Corporate Accountant to join our team in Thomasville, GA. The Corporate Accountant is responsible for providing accounting and financial reporting support for the corporate office. This includes understanding and supporting Corporate Accounting through overall management of the general ledger, accounting issues, detail analysis and presentation of financial data, preparation and recording of journal entries, preparation and review of monthly account reconciliations, and other similar activities or ad hoc requests.

Job Location:

Thomasville, GA

Essential functions:
  • Assist with month, quarter and year-end close processes
  • Prepare assigned monthly account reconciliations
  • Assist with monthly spending variance analysis, including research, documentation and communication of spending variances
  • Assist in the daily maintenance of the corporate general ledger to ensure accuracy and consistency with Company policy and compliance with GAAP
  • Support peers and management with internal and external projects
  • Assist with audit preparation and pulling required requests and documentation
  • Assist in day-to-day maintenance of ledger accounts
  • Performs other duties as assigned
